I suspect that it is because you put your constant names in quotes, and as 
a result the keys are going to be wrong.  i.e. you 
have 'CURLOPT_SSL_VERIFYPEER' => true, while it should probably be 
CURLOPT_SSL_VERIFYPEER => true as shown in the link you provided.
